As Women’s League football in the country moves its train to Ijebu Ode, Ogun State, South West Nigeria for the Nigeria Women Football League Super 6 tournament, the Authentic Nigeria Football and Allied Sports Supporters Club, ANFASSC is calling on all football stakeholders to give the tournament the support it deserves.
The Super 6, which is scheduled to hold at the Dipo Dina stadium, Ijebu Ode starting from tomorrow, Monday, 19 April 2021, is a prerequisite for Nigeria’s WAFU Women’s Champions League Zonal qualifiers.
President of the foremost supporters club, Prince Abayomi Ogunjimi said Aisha Falode and her team have done well on their part, adding that it behoves on stakeholders to support the moving train”.
“I am appealing to everyone to continue supporting the Women football project, thankfully we now have the CAF club tournament for women, this will further propel us to greatness on the continent”.
Bayelsa Queens, Delta Queens and Rivers Angels FC are competing for the top Prize in the tournament, others in town are Edo Queens, FC Robo and Sunshine Queens.
